Transaction e002766c72fa96fb8d09aa9068f11713e0a8345ee8566a47682cc1c30ae22542

2 Input
2 Outputs
  • e002766c72fa96fb8d09aa9068f11713e0a8345ee8566a47682cc1c30ae22542:0
  • value  21090
    address  1D4aRgVHLRMkyYBt27TFMH87XgpLLZa3T5
  • e002766c72fa96fb8d09aa9068f11713e0a8345ee8566a47682cc1c30ae22542:1
  • value  19103790
    address  1KKWmv74uTEGd8H9fBwYnKF1St9vRJ5iRx